## Step 4: Encoding detection

When migrating to Textgate 3, uploaded text files are no longer assumed to be UTF-8. The new detection module samples the first 64 KB and falls back to the tenant's declared locale if confidence is low. Legacy uploads from the Brayford importer must be re-scanned before cut-over, or they will render as mojibake. Before enabling detection in staging, apply the following settings exactly as shown below.

settings of tagef-bawif:
DRUIX_HOST=druix.zemvarlabs.internal
DRUIX_PORT=8000

Team,

As of the next Glyphden release, all third-party fonts are vendored into the core bundle. Plugin authors: stop shipping your own copies of the Merrow typeface family — duplicates will be stripped at build time. Update your manifests before Friday's cutoff. Licensing questions go to the platform channel. The release build this applies to is identified by the token below.

pipeline stamp: htk3_cc5

Environments: Corvella Ingest — Encoding Detection

All environments of the Corvella ingest service run the same encoding-detection pass on uploaded text files. The detector samples the first 64 KB, scores candidate encodings, and falls back to UTF-8 with replacement characters when confidence is low. Staging uses a lower confidence threshold than production to surface edge cases earlier. Maintainers should keep the two environments aligned otherwise. The detection settings applied per environment are configured as follows.

deployment values, yahag-tawef:
ZORWYN_HOST=zorwyn.tolvaqlabs.internal
ZORWYN_PORT=9300

## Runbook: tailfish log tailing CLI

The tailfish CLI streams logs from the Murkwater aggregation tier. Access is scoped per environment; production tailing requires an approved session ticket. All tail sessions are recorded and retained for 30 days for audit. Reviewers validating the audit path can run tailfish in read-only staging mode, which authenticates against the Murkwater staging endpoint using the service key below.

service key, tadup-yagep: kto23_Eoog5Djh7wQNnUcbvpYZZfG